What is in Hazy Little Thing?

Water, Munich malt, Two-row Pale malt, oats, wheat, Citra hops, El Dorado hops, Magnum hops, Simcoe hops, Comet hops and yeast.

How many calories are in Hazy Little Thing?

214 calories per 12 oz serving, mostly from 20.6g carbs and alcohol.
